Creating Effective Motor Control Circuits
Motor control circuits are the foundation of any electrical system requiring precise operation. Constructing effective motor control circuits requires a comprehensive grasp of both electrical and mechanical principles.
The methodology begins with selecting the appropriate motor for the specific application. Factors like motor torque, speed, and output must be carefully considered. Once the motor is chosen, a suitable actuation mechanism must be designed to regulate its operation.
Frequent control strategies include pulse width modulation (PWM), which adjusts the duty cycle of a signal to influence motor speed and torque. Other strategies may involve position sensing to achieve precise alignment.
Furthermore, safety considerations are paramount. This includes implementing features such as overload protection and emergency stop mechanisms.
The final outcome is a reliable and efficient motor control circuit that facilitates precise control of the associated device.

Proactive Maintenance in Industrial Automation
In the realm of industrial automation, productivity is paramount. To achieve this, manufacturers are increasingly adopting predictive maintenance strategies. This involves exploiting real-time data from sensors and machines to predict potential failures before they occur. By pinpointing anomalies in operational parameters, predictive maintenance allows for timely intervention, decreasing downtime and enhancing overall system robustness.
- Advantages of Predictive Maintenance include:
- Lowered Downtime
- Increased Equipment Lifespan
- Financial Gains
- Enhanced Safety
